Information on the case from local sources, may or may not be correct : Dixon was last seen in Sherman, Texas on September 28, 2006. She left her apartment on west Taylor Street to go for a walk and never returned. has never been heard from again. Her cigarette case, which she always carried, was found after her disappearance and turned in to the Denison, Texas police department.
Dixon's loved ones are concerned for her welfare, as her disappearance is uncharacteristic of her behavior. She left behind three children. Few details are available in her case. Both Sherman and Denison police are investigating.

A missing person is a person who has disappeared and whose status as alive or dead cannot be confirmed as their location and condition are not known. A person may go missing through a voluntary disappearance, or else due to an accident, crime, death in a location where they cannot be found (such as at sea), or many other reasons. In most parts of the world, a missing person will usually be found quickly. While criminal abductions are some of the most widely reported missing person cases, these account for only 2�5% of missing children in Europe. By contrast, some missing person cases remain unresolved for many years. Laws related to these cases are often complex since, in many jurisdictions, relatives and third parties may not deal with a person's assets until their death is considered proven by law and a formal death certificate issued. The situation, uncertainties, and lack of closure or a funeral resulting when a person goes missing may be extremely painful with long-lasting effects on family and friends.
